New Honda Jazz With CVT and Paddle Shifters Coming to India?

The next all-new product to come out of Honda's stables in India will be the new-generation Jazz, which will enter the highly competitive premium hatchback segment. To perform well in a segment with contenders like Hyundai i20, Maruti Swift and Volkswagen Polo, Honda will focus on two areas - high fuel efficiency and advanced features.
Powering the new-gen Honda Jazz will be the same engines that also power the Amaze i.e. the 1.2-litre i-VTEC and 1.5-litre i-DTEC. Both the engines are known for high fuel-efficiency and decent power. While the 1.2-litre i-VTEC engine churns out a maximum power output of 87bhp and 109Nm of torque, the 1.5-litre i-DTEC produces 99bhp and 200Nm.

While the regular models will be offered with a 5-speed manual gearbox, the line-up might also include a performance-oriented model that will house the 1.5-litre i-VTEC motor under the hood and come mated to a 5-speed CVT gearbox. The performance model might also feature first-in-segment paddle shifters. In fact, the company has already imported paddle shifters from Thailand for testing purpose in India. That said, there is no clarity if the company will launch the CVT model along with the regular models or later.

If launched, the model with the CVT and paddle shifters will cost around Rs 1 lakh more than the regular variant.
